Talent.com
No longer accepting applications
Data Engineer

Data Engineer

Randstad CanadaVancouver, British Columbia, CA
30+ days ago
Job type
  • Temporary
  • Quick Apply
Job description

Are you an experienced Data Engineer in search of your next contract opportunity? Our high-profile client is seeking to hire a Lead Data engineer to join their talented team on a 6-month contract with a strong probability of extension. Apply for this amazing opportunity if this sounds like a good fit for you!

Advantages

What’s in it for you!

As a consultant with our client, you’ll receive :

  • Highly competitive market hourly rates
  • A 6 month contract with a strong probability of extension
  • Remote interview process

Responsibilities

Design and implement data pipelines, ETL / ELT workflows, and data architectures using Snowflake and Azure services for efficient data processing.

Optimize Snowflake performance through query tuning, data partitioning, and leveraging Azure tools for scalable management.

Ensure data security, compliance, and governance with encryption, access controls, and auditing in Snowflake and Azure.

Collaborate with cross-functional teams to align data solutions with business goals and technical requirements.

Mentor junior engineers, promoting best practices and continuous learning in data engineering.

Qualifications

Intermediate to Senior Data Engineer with 3+ years of experience

Must have Azure and Snowflake hands-on experience, preferably in large-scale enterprise data projects

Hands on and a minimum of 2 projects experience with Azure and Snowflake

Experience being the technical lead of a group of data engineers, mentorship, and driving solutions to meet complex requirements

Good understanding of modern data platforms including data lakes and data warehouse, with good knowledge of the underlying architecture, preferably in Snowflake

Proven experience in assembling large, complex sets of data that meets non-functional and functional business requirements

Experience in identifying, designing, and implementing integration, modelling, and orchestration of complex Finance data and at the same time look for process improvements, optimize data delivery and automate manual processes

Working experience of scripting, data science, and analytics (SQL, Python, PowerShell, JavaScript)

Working experience of performance tuning and optimization, bottleneck problems analysis, and technical troubleshooting in a, sometimes, ambiguous environment

Working experience of working with cloud based systems (Azure experience preferred)

Working knowledge of CI / CD

Technical expertise to build code that is performant as well as secure

Technical depth and vision to perform POC’s and evaluate different technologies

Experience with Real Time Analytics and Real Time Messaging

Working knowledge of building data integrity checks as part of delivery of applications

Experience working with Kafka technologies

Design, implement and monitor 'best practices' for Dev framework

Experience working with large volume data; retail experience strongly desired

In depth knowledge with hands-on experience in building pipelines with Azure Data Factory (ADF)

Hands-on experience in Azure Data Lake Storage (ADLS), Key Vault, Logic Apps, DevOps (CI / CD) are highly preferred

Good understanding of data lake and data warehouse architecture

Proven experience in assembling large, complex sets of data that meets non-functional and functional business requirements

Experience in identifying, designing, and building integration, modelling, and orchestration of complex Finance data and at the same time look for process improvements, optimize data delivery and automate manual processes

Working experience of performance tuning and optimization and technical troubleshooting

Technical expertise to build code that is performant

Working knowledge of building data validation, data cleansing and data integrity checks as part of delivery of ETL pipelines

Design, implement and monitor 'best practices' for Dev framework

Willing to work in a fast paced and result-driven environment

Summary

If you are a Lead Data Engineer and the prospect of joining a dedicated team intrigues you, then this role with our high-profile client could be the perfect opportunity for you.

Apply below or reach out to your Randstad representative for more information.

Randstad Canada is committed to fostering a workforce reflective of all peoples of Canada. As a result, we are committed to developing and implementing strategies to increase the equity, diversity and inclusion within the workplace by examining our internal policies, practices, and systems throughout the entire lifecycle of our workforce, including its recruitment, retention and advancement for all employees. In addition to our deep commitment to respecting human rights, we are dedicated to positive actions to affect change to ensure everyone has full participation in the workforce free from any barriers, systemic or otherwise, especially equity-seeking groups who are usually underrepresented in Canada's workforce, including those who identify as women or non-binary / gender non-conforming; Indigenous or Aboriginal Peoples; persons with disabilities (visible or invisible) and; members of visible minorities, racialized groups and the LGBTQ2+ community.

Randstad Canada is committed to creating and maintaining an inclusive and accessible workplace for all its candidates and employees by supporting their accessibility and accommodation needs throughout the employment lifecycle. We ask that all job applications please identify any accommodation requirements by sending an email to [email protected] to ensure their ability to fully participate in the interview process.